Helping Haiti from Home:  How Local Efforts Can Support International Disaster Relief

Symposium Against Global Indifference presents Bertin Meance, a Haitan who studied English at Ashland, worked with a foundation to re-build homes and a school in a small town in Haiti devistated by the 2010 earthquake.  He shows how contributions from America and other countries can help local people re-build their homes and lives without going through bureaucratic processes to get aid.

Free & Open to the Public.

Cosponsored by the Department of Social Work and Multicultural Programming Committee.
